What You Will Do

Aid employers and their potentially affected workers who experience layoffs and closures (reactive services) or require services to prevent such situations (proactive services).

Build successful partnerships and collaborate with local partners (county staff) or assigned counties/local workforce areas, as well as employers in those areas.

Each Account Executive covers approximately 15-25 counties in a geographical area. You may serve as backup to your peers in other geographical areas as needed.

  • Research layoffs and closures
  • Outreach to employers
  • Establish rapport and nurture ongoing relationships with partners and impacted employers
  • Attend local partner meetings
  • Organize and lead initial employer meetings to promote Rapid Response services
  • Present the standardized Rapid Response PowerPoint Presentation to dislocated workers at Rapid Response Reemployment Sessions, both in person and virtually (as requested)
  • Affiliate with resume and interviewing workshops, job fairs, and hiring events as needed
  • Support case management and data entry
  • Perform other duties as assigned

Pay Information

  • This position is in the State of Ohio’s, Pay Range 31.
  • Unless required by legislation or union contract, starting salary will be the minimum salary of that pay range step 1, $28.76 per hour.
  • These ranges provide a standardized pathway for pay increases. With continued employment, new hires move to the next step in the range after 6 months and annually thereafter.
  • Cost of Living Adjustments increase wages in these ranges each fiscal year.
  • Pay Range 31 Step 1: $28.76
  • Step 2: $30.10
  • Step 3: $31.47
  • Step 4: $32.84
  • Step 5: $34.53
  • Step 6: $36.20
  • Step 7: $38.01
